IME it's hit and miss. We tried to visit AKL just to see the animals on a rest day recently and were turned away but we've never had issues parking at Contemporary to shop, which others have said is the hardest resort to pop into without a dining reservation.
Be prepared to be turned away and pleasantly surprised if you aren't

That was my experience last month. We did have dining reservations at Whispering Canyon, but we were not asked or anything when we used a boat from MK to get there. We were never asked anything when using Disney Transport.
